Roof waterproofing services involve applying specialized coatings or membranes to a roof’s surface to prevent water from penetrating into the building. This process helps create a barrier that keeps rain, snow, and moisture from seeping through roof materials, which can lead to interior damage and structural issues. The work often includes inspecting the roof for existing damage, cleaning the surface thoroughly, and then applying the appropriate waterproofing materials to ensure a durable, long-lasting seal. Properly waterproofed roofs can significantly reduce the risk of leaks and water-related problems, helping maintain the integrity of the property over time.
Many common problems can be addressed with professional roof waterproofing. For example, aging roofs that have developed cracks or worn membranes are more vulnerable to leaks during heavy rain or snowmelt. Additionally, properties with flat or low-slope roofs are especially prone to water pooling, which can accelerate deterioration if not properly sealed. Waterproofing can also help prevent mold growth, wood rot, and damage to insulation or interior finishes caused by water infiltration. Homeowners who notice signs of water stains, increased humidity, or moisture in their attic or ceilings may benefit from a waterproofing assessment.

The overview below groups typical Roof Waterpro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Madison Heights,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or roof waterproofing repairs in Madison Heights range from $250 to $600. These projects often involve sealing small leaks or cracks and are common for routine maintenance. Many local contractors handle jobs within this range.
Medium-Sized Projects - For more extensive waterproofing work, such as coating larger roof sections, costs generally fall between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common for homes needing comprehensive sealing to prevent future leaks.
Full Roof Coatings - Complete roof waterproofing with professional coatings usually costs from $3,500 to $7,000. Larger, more complex projects, such as multi-story buildings, can reach $10,000+ but are less frequent.
Complete Roof Replacement - When waterproofing is part of a full roof replacement, costs can range from $8,000 to over $20,000 depending on the size and materials used. These larger projects are less common but are necessary for severely damaged roofs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of waterproofing? Roof waterproofing involves applying materials or treatments to prevent water from penetrating the roof structure, helping to protect the building from leaks and water damage.
How do local contractors perform roof waterproofing? Contractors typically assess the roof's condition, clean the surface, and then apply waterproof membranes, coatings, or sealants to ensure a water-resistant barrier.
What types of waterproofing methods are available for roofs? Common methods include liquid membrane coatings, sheet membranes, and bituminous coatings, each suited for different roof types and conditions.
